Apple warns iPhone users to update their devices. Here’s why

(CNN) — Apple is urging iPhone and iPad users to update to its latest operating systems to keep their devices safe.

The company said the new iOS 26.5 and iPadOS 26.5 address a lengthy list of security flaws.

Apple said it is also introducing support for end-to-end encrypted RCS messaging at the beta level.

Experts said hackers are using artificial intelligence to find new ways to attack phones and tablets.
